By Lucio                                              S.B. No. 1420
         76R9243 T                           
                                A BILL TO BE ENTITLED
 1-1                                   AN ACT
 1-2     relating to authorizing the Board of Regents of The University of
 1-3     Texas System to acquire by purchase, exchange, gift, or otherwise
 1-4     certain properties to be used for campus expansion and university
 1-5     purposes in The University of Texas System.
 1-6           B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F TEXAS:
 1-7           SECTION 1.  The Board of Regents of The University of Texas
 1-8     System is hereby authorized to acquire by purchase, exchange, gift,
 1-9     or otherwise, for campus expansion and for other University
1-10     purposes, all or any part of the land described as:  (a)  A tract
1-11     of land containing 64.16 acres more or less, in the City of
1-12     Edinburg, Texas, being all of Lot 10, the West 20 acres of Lot 9,
1-13     and the East 361 feet of the South 659 feet of Lot 14, all in
1-14     Section 242, Texas-Mexican Railway Company Survey, per map recorded
1-15     in Volume 1, Page 12,  Deed Records of said County, together with
1-16     all street, alleys, alleyways, railroads, thoroughfares, whether or
1-17     not vacated lying within or adjoining said 64.16 acre tract of
1-18     land, specifically including but not limited to all those portions
1-19     of Schunior, Garner and Chapin Streets, and Sugar Road.
1-20           (b)  A tract of land containing 10.5 acres, more or less, out
1-21     of Lots 1 and 4 Black A, Section 242 as shown on Edinburg Original
1-22     Townsite Map, recorded in Volume 1, Page 3, Map Records of Hidalgo
1-23     County, Texas, said 10.5 acre tract of land being that certain
1-24     portion of land in said Lots 1 and 4 lying West of the centerline
 2-1     of First Avenue together with all streets, alleys, alleyways,
 2-2     railroads, thoroughfares, whether or not vacated lying within or
 2-3     adjoining said 10.5 acre tract of land, specifically including but
 2-4     not limited to all those portions of Schunior, Chavez, Cooper,
 2-5     Smith, and Garner Street, and 1st Avenue.
 2-6           (c)  A tract of land containing 26.7 acres, more or less, in
 2-7     the City of Edinburg, Texas, being Lots 5, 6, 7 and 8 of Block
 2-8     Ninety Four (94), Lots 5, 6, 7 and 8 of block One Hundred and
 2-9     Twenty Seven (127), Lots 5, 6, 7 and 8 of Block One Hundred and
2-10     Thirty Eight (138), Lots 5, 6, 7 and 8 of Block One Hundred and
2-11     Seventy One (171), Lots 5, 6, 7 and 8 of Block One Hundred and
2-12     Eighty Two (182), Lots 5, 6, 7 and 8 of Block Two Hundred and
2-13     Fifteen (215), Lots 5, 6, 7 and 8 if Block Two Hundred and Twenty
2-14     Six (226), all of Blocks One Hundred and Fifty Nine (159), One
2-15     Hundred and Seventy (170), One Hundred and Eighty Three (183), One
2-16     Hundred and Sixty Nine (169), and the North 280 feet of Block One
2-17     Hundred and Eighty Four (184), all in Edinburg Original Townsite
2-18     Map, recorded in Volume 1, Page 23, Map Records of Hidalgo County,
2-19     Texas; together with all streets, alleys, alleyways, railroads,
2-20     thoroughfares, whether or not vacated lying within or adjoining
2-21     said 10.5 acre tract of land, specifically including but not
2-22     limited to all those portions of Fifth, Sixth, Seventh and Eighth
2-23     Avenues, and Schunior, Van Week, Lovette, Peter, Loeb, Kuhn,
2-24     McIntyre and Harriman Streets, and the Southern Pacific Railroad.
2-25           SECTION 2.  The importance of this legislation and the
2-26     crowded condition of the calendars in both houses create an
2-27     emergency and an imperative public necessity that the
 3-1     constitutional rule requiring bills to be read on three several
 3-2     days in each house be suspended, and this rule is hereby suspended,
 3-3     and that this Act take effect and be in force from and after its
 3-4     passage, and it is so enacted.
